What is Firebug?

Firebug is an add-on for the Firefox web browser. Firebug integrates with Firefox to put a wealth of development tools at your fingertips while you browse. You can edit, debug, and monitor CSS, HTML, and JavaScript live in any web page...

Further enhancements

  • Some enhancements to make Firebug even more powerful: Mehr Power für Firebug (list of 10 enhancements, in German, but you can follow the links). Here are some of them:

FirePHP

FirePHP: FirePHP enables you to log to your Firebug Console using a simple PHP method call. - There's a FirePHP plugin for Moodle in the works.

FireRainbow

FireRainbow (formerly Rainbow for Firebug)- provides JavaScript syntax highlighting for Firebug 1.3.

CodeBurner

CodeBurner - a Firefox add-on that integrates with Firebug, to extend it with reference material for HTML and CSS.
